Understanding Tiona's Unique Soil and Climate Conditions

Tiona's location in the Allegheny Plateau region presents specific challenges that influence aggregate selection. The area is characterized by Alton and Cavode soil series—moderately deep to deep, well-drained soils formed from glacial till and residuum from shale and siltstone bedrock. These clay-rich soils have moderate permeability but can experience significant expansion and contraction during freeze-thaw cycles.

With average annual precipitation around 45 inches and winter temperatures frequently dropping below freezing from November through March, proper drainage and stable base materials are essential for any construction project in Tiona. Properties near the Tionesta Creek watershed or in low-lying areas near Sheffield require particularly careful attention to drainage solutions to prevent water accumulation and frost heave damage.

Best Aggregates for Tiona Driveways

For the most durable driveways in the Tiona region, we recommend a multi-layer approach using our premium aggregates. The crusher run base provides exceptional compaction and stability, while properly sized surface stone ensures excellent drainage and traction during winter months. This combination handles the 100+ inches of annual snowfall common to Warren County while maintaining structural integrity through spring thaws.

Many homeowners in Barnes and Youngsville have found that a 4-inch base layer topped with 2 inches of surface aggregate creates driveways that last 15-20 years with minimal maintenance. The angular nature of crushed stone aggregates allows them to lock together, preventing rutting and washout during heavy spring rains that often accompany snowmelt.

French Drains and Drainage Systems

French drains installed with proper angular aggregates effectively channel water away from foundations and low-lying areas. The key is selecting stone that provides maximum void space for water flow while preventing fine particles from washing into and clogging the system. Properties near the Tionesta Creek floodplain or in the Barnes area particularly benefit from professionally designed drainage using our premium drain rock.

For Tiona's clay soils, we recommend surrounding drainage pipes with 6-12 inches of clean, angular aggregate wrapped in geotextile fabric. This prevents the migration of clay particles while maintaining optimal water flow. Calculating Aggregate Quantities

For driveways in Tiona, we recommend a minimum 4-inch depth of compacted base material, which provides the stability needed to withstand freeze-thaw cycles and heavy snow removal equipment. To calculate cubic yards needed, measure length times width in feet, multiply by depth in feet, then divide by 27. For example, a 12-foot wide by 60-foot long driveway with 4 inches of depth requires approximately 9 cubic yards of base material.

Drainage projects typically require less material but demand precise installation. French drains generally use 6-12 inches of aggregate around perforated pipes, while surface drainage swales may need 4-6 inches of stone. The clay content of Tiona soils means drainage projects cannot be skimped—investing in adequate aggregate now prevents expensive foundation repairs later.

Seasonal Considerations

While we deliver year-round throughout Warren County, spring and fall offer ideal conditions for major aggregate projects. Spring installation after the ground thaws but before heavy summer vegetation growth works well for drainage systems. Fall installation before winter freeze gives crushed stone driveways time to settle before facing their first winter.
